More than 1,000 partners from the private sector, government and civil society are working together through the 2030 water resources group Semiconductor manufacturing requires huge amounts of water to form ultrapure water, impacting the local environment and needing innovation and scrutiny. This multistakeholder collaboration aims to ensure availability and sustainable management of water and sanitation for all by 2030.

The world is facing a growing challenge of water scarcity, which is set to accelerate this century Protecting the global water cycle can help us achieve many of the sdgs While already in use in manufacturing and agriculture, digital twins could also be transformative for the water management industry

Already, case studies are emerging on how digital twins in water management can improve efficiency, saving clean water and improving services.

Access to freshwater is changing rapidly, with water stress affecting billions of people and countless businesses each year. Japan is reimagining water infrastructure with tech, transparency, and collaboration to boost resilience amid ageing systems and climate challenges. Water scarcity, pollution and extreme weather events driven by climate change, population growth and industrial demand are pushing global water systems to critical levels Established at davos in 2008 by the world economic forum and now housed at the world bank, wrg convenes governments, businesses, and civil society to develop scalable water solutions
